OJPC is a non-profit law firm representing people who have been marginalized by the criminal justice system and advocating evidence-based criminal justice reform. We work to improve prison conditions and protect inmates’ rights so they have a better chance at improving themselves while incarcerated. We also work to overcome the invisible punishments that prevent people with criminal records from fully participating in their families and communities. And we work to identify and eliminate racial disparity in Ohio’s criminal justice system.
